Tire Monitoring System: Service and Repair




TPMS Reset
After you replace a low pressure tire, the Low Tire Pressure indicator may blink or illuminate in 10 minutes after driving because the TPMS sensor mounted on the wheel is not initiated. Once the low pressure tire is reinflated to the recommended pressure and installed on the vehicle or the TPMS sensor mounted on the replaced spare wheel is initiated by an authorized HYUNDAI dealer, the TPMS malfunction indicator and the low tire pressure indicator will turn off within a few minutes of driving.
